How to Place Your Phone on a Table: Why Keeping the Screen Down Can Benefit You

Do you place your smartphone on a table with the screen facing up? If yes, you might be putting both your phone and yourself at risk. While it may seem like a small habit, the way you place your phone can have significant benefits if done correctly. Here’s why keeping your phone screen-down on a table is smarter.

Protect Your Privacy
When the screen faces up, your phone becomes like an open book. Bank alerts, personal messages, office emails, and other notifications are easily visible to anyone nearby. Placing the phone screen-down eliminates the risk of prying eyes, ensuring your sensitive data stays private. In today’s world, protecting your identity and personal information is crucial, making this simple habit highly effective.

Enhances Focus
We all know the trap: picking up the phone for a small task and ending up scrolling reels or social media for hours. When the phone screen faces down, the “check me” temptation decreases. This allows you to focus more on your work, conversations, or surroundings, helping you stay present, calm, and mentally focused.

Protects Your Phone’s Screen and Camera
Screen-down placement safeguards your phone from spills, crumbs, dust, and scratches. It also protects the camera lens from rubbing against flat surfaces. Additionally, the chances of your phone slipping off the table or falling reduce, giving your device better physical protection.

Helps Save Battery Life
Notifications prompt us to unlock and check our phones repeatedly, draining battery quickly. With the screen hidden, notifications don’t grab your attention instantly, reducing unnecessary phone use and extending battery life. This habit encourages controlled phone usage rather than letting the device dictate your actions.

Builds a Healthier Relationship with Your Phone
Smartphones are an integral part of our lives, but maintaining a balanced relationship with them is essential. Keeping the screen down creates space between you and your device, allowing you to be truly present with others. Even when alone, it prevents unnecessary phone checks, fostering a more mindful, peaceful, and controlled digital life.

In short, a simple habit like placing your phone screen-down can enhance privacy, focus, device safety, battery life, and overall well-being—proving that small changes often lead to big benefits.
